PageRenderTime 44ms CodeModel.GetById 41ms app.highlight 1ms RepoModel.GetById 1ms app.codeStats 0ms

/protocols/ss7/map/map-api/src/main/java/org/mobicents/protocols/ss7/map/api/service/lsm/SupportedLCSCapabilitySets.java

http://mobicents.googlecode.com/
Java | 56 lines | 8 code | 7 blank | 41 comment | 0 complexity | ad570c4d23e6d43a02edef4cb7807a33 MD5 | raw file
 1/*
 2 * JBoss, Home of Professional Open Source
 3 * Copyright 2011, Red Hat, Inc. and/or its affiliates, and individual
 4 * contributors as indicated by the @authors tag. All rights reserved.
 5 * See the copyright.txt in the distribution for a full listing
 6 * of individual contributors.
 7 * 
 8 * This copyrighted material is made available to anyone wishing to use,
 9 * modify, copy, or redistribute it subject to the terms and conditions
10 * of the GNU General Public License, v. 2.0.
11 * 
12 * This program is distributed in the hope that it will be useful,
13 * but WITHOUT ANY WARRANTY; without even the implied warranty of 
14 * MERCHANTABILITY or FITNESS FOR A PARTICULAR PURPOSE. See the GNU 
15 * General Public License for more details.
16 * 
17 * You should have received a copy of the GNU General Public License,
18 * v. 2.0 along with this distribution; if not, write to the Free 
19 * Software Foundation, Inc., 51 Franklin Street, Fifth Floor, Boston,
20 * MA 02110-1301, USA.
21 */
22package org.mobicents.protocols.ss7.map.api.service.lsm;
23
24import java.io.Serializable;
25
26/**
27 * 
28 * SupportedLCS-CapabilitySets ::= BIT STRING {
29 *		lcsCapabilitySet1 (0),
30 *		lcsCapabilitySet2 (1),
31 *		lcsCapabilitySet3 (2),
32 *		lcsCapabilitySet4 (3) } (SIZE (2..16))
33 *	-- Core network signalling capability set1 indicates LCS Release98 or Release99 version.
34 *	-- Core network signalling capability set2 indicates LCS Release4.
35 *	-- Core network signalling capability set3 indicates LCS Release5.
36 *	-- Core network signalling capability set4 indicates LCS Release6 or later version.
37 *	-- A node shall mark in the BIT STRING all LCS capability sets it supports.
38 *	-- If no bit is set then the sending node does not support LCS.
39 *	-- If the parameter is not sent by an VLR then the VLR may support at most capability set1.
40 *	-- If the parameter is not sent by an SGSN then no support for LCS is assumed.
41 *	-- An SGSN is not allowed to indicate support of capability set1.
42 *	-- Other bits than listed above shall be discarded.
43 * @author amit bhayani
44 *
45 */
46public interface SupportedLCSCapabilitySets extends Serializable {
47	
48	public boolean getLcsCapabilitySet1();
49	
50	public boolean getLcsCapabilitySet2();
51	
52	public boolean getLcsCapabilitySet3();
53	
54	public boolean getLcsCapabilitySet4();
55
56}